Job Description

Email Marketing Specialist

Ducks Unlimited, a leading conservation organization, is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Email Marketing Specialist to support the execution and growth of our email marketing program. This role focuses on hands-on email deployment, content coordination, and performance monitoring while working closely with internal teams and external agency partners who support analytics and lifecycle strategy.

This is an ideal role for someone who enjoys building and optimizing campaigns and wants to grow into a more strategic lifecycle marketing role over time. We are seeking a creative and data-aware professional with 13 years of experience in email or digital marketing who is eager to learn and grow within a collaborative, mission-driven environ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Email Execution & Deployment
    • Build, QA, and deploy email campaigns, newsletters, and lifecycle communications
    • Ensure emails are accurate, on-brand, and delivered on schedule
    • Maintain consistency across devices, inbox providers, and templates
  • Performance Monitoring & Optimization Support
    • Review campaign performance using established dashboards and reports
    • Monitor key metrics such as opens, clicks, engagement, and conversions
    • Implement testing and optimization recommendations from internal leadership and agency partners
    • Identify and flag performance trends or anomalies for further analysis
  • Email Calendar & Schedule Coordination
    • Manage the email marketing calendar and campaign timelines
    • Work closely with internal stakeholders to align messaging across campaigns
    • Communicate requirements, deadlines, and updates to cross-functional teams
  • Newsletter & Campaign Content Support
    • Collaborate with content and creative teams to develop compelling email messaging
    • Ensure alignment with Ducks Unlimited's mission, brand voice, and audience expectations
    • Support layout and structural improvements to enhance readability and engagement
  • Template Management & Technical Support
    • Customize and maintain email templates using drag-and-drop editors and reusable components
    • Troubleshoot minor rendering or formatting issues across devices and inboxes
    • Help ensure templates remain optimized and reusable across campaigns
  • Data Awareness & Continuous Improvement
    • Review digital marketing performance data and apply insights to improve execution
    • Contribute to and support email acquisition and list growth initiatives, playing a key role in expanding Ducks Unlimited's subscriber base over time
    • Stay informed on email marketing trends, tools, and best practices
    • Support ongoing testing and optimization initiatives within the email channel
  • Agency Collaboration & Strategic Development
    • Partner closely with external agency teams supporting analytics and lifecycle strategy
    • Implement lifecycle and optimization recommendations within email platforms
    • Provide execution feedback and operational insights to support strategic initiatives
    • Develop an understanding of lifecycle marketing concepts and campaign optimization over time
  • Organization & Process Management
    • Maintain organized documentation of campaigns, templates, and schedules
    • Use office and collaboration tools to manage assets and workflows efficiently
    • Support continuous improvement of internal email processes and documentation
